The truck incurred $3300 damage in maybe 15 sec.The two tires will still have the same dimensions and fit on the same wheel. The D rated tire has a higher capacity. For a ST175/80D13 like # AM1ST77, the capacity is 1,610 pounds at 65 psi. For a C load range in the same size, like # AM1ST76 , the capacity is 1,360 pounds at 50 psi. A tire with a load index equal to that of the Original Equipment tire indicates an equivalent load capacity. A tire with a lower load index than the Original Equipment tire indicates the tire does not equal the load capacity of the original. Typically, the load indexes of the tires used on passenger cars and light trucks range from 70 to 110.Aug 21, 2023 · Load range D and E tires have different weight capacities. For example, a load range D tire can handle 1,220 lbs at 65 PSI, while an E tires carry loads at 80 PSI. For example, I just swapped out the D rated tires on my Duramax for E rated, I could feel the difference on the road.The speed rating of a tire is usually molded into the sidewall of a tire along with the tire size designation. It is usually the last metric displayed in the tire size sequence. Tire speed ratings are paired with the load index. The load index is a 2 or 3 digit number followed by the letter designation of the speed rating.

Photo was taken in 2017.The Load Range on a tire's sidewall indicates its ply rating, which represents the tire's strength and load-carrying capacity. For instance, a Load Range E typically corresponds to a 10-ply rating.
